Requests for information under the Freedom of Information (Scotland) Act 2002 should be submitted to the following member of staff at the RSAMD: Caroline Cochrane
Telephone: +44 (0) 141 270 8269 E-mail: foi@rsamd.ac.uk Requests must be in writing, or in any other format capable of being referred to (e.g. e-mail). The request should include the applicant's name and address, the information required giving as many details as may be necessary to assist in locating the information and the format in which the information is required. Ms. Cochrane will be happy to advise and assist as necessary. Data Protection subject access request should be made to:
